How to Identify a Hidden Failure Before the Project Is Foiled

In the complex lifecycle of corporate development, the ability to detect a hidden failure within a project’s infrastructure is often the only thing standing between a successful launch and a public disaster. Many teams fall into the trap of “optimism bias,” where positive surface-level reports mask deep-seated technical or logistical flaws that are slowly eroding the project’s foundation. These issues often begin as minor inconsistencies in data or small delays in the supply chain, but if left unaddressed, they can snowball into systemic collapses. A proactive manager must look beyond the green lights on a dashboard and investigate the “shadow metrics” that reveal the true health of the operation.

One of the most common signs of a hidden failure is a sudden drop in team morale or a lack of transparent communication between departments. When developers or engineers feel that their concerns are being ignored by upper management, they may stop reporting minor bugs or process inefficiencies to avoid conflict. This “silence culture” is a breeding ground for catastrophic errors that only become visible when it is too late to fix them without significant financial loss. Establishing a “blameless post-mortem” culture where staff are encouraged to speak up about potential risks is essential for maintaining the integrity of the project and ensuring that every stakeholder is working with the same set of facts.

Technical debt is another significant source of hidden failure that often goes unnoticed during the early stages of rapid growth. When a company prioritizes speed of delivery over the quality of the underlying code or architecture, they are essentially borrowing against their future stability. This debt accumulates interest in the form of increased maintenance costs and a higher frequency of system crashes. To identify this risk, leaders should conduct regular “stress tests” on their systems to see how they perform under heavy loads or unexpected variables. By identifying where the “cracks” are before the pressure is on, the team can fortify the structure and ensure a smooth rollout for the end-user.

External factors, such as shifting market trends or changes in regulatory compliance, can also lead to a hidden failure if the project is too rigid to adapt. A plan that looked perfect six months ago may no longer be relevant in a fast-moving digital economy. This is why “agile” methodologies have become the standard for modern business, allowing for continuous feedback and course correction throughout the development cycle. By treating the project as a living organism that must respond to its environment, managers can pivot away from failing strategies before they become “sunk costs” that drain the company’s resources and damage its reputation in the competitive global marketplace.
